Transaction e61dae33ab4292b48c51ecefd02f43b66af6947c812a9dd9a804ccd707b6ef6f

1 Input
2 Outputs
  • e61dae33ab4292b48c51ecefd02f43b66af6947c812a9dd9a804ccd707b6ef6f:0
  • value  1934000000
    address  34DQaTkXuzUuAS4NAdPrcwYuhEcamfWrCJ
  • e61dae33ab4292b48c51ecefd02f43b66af6947c812a9dd9a804ccd707b6ef6f:1
  • value  206121
    address  bc1q6ypey56nj0r085whp6p2qvd2en5xmpeq4awuep